I have the following code that's supposed to scan a bar code and decode it's value.
The problem is that arrayofbars[] is empty and doesn't get any value
private static int readbarcode(Bitmap image){
string [] arrayofbars=new string[250];
for (int x = 0; x < image.Width; x++)
{ int i=0;
for (int y = 0; y < image.Height; y++)
{
Color pixel = image.GetPixel(x, y);
//get every black color and put it in an arrayofbars[]
if(pixel==Color.Black){
arrayofbars[i]="b"; i++;
}
else for(int j=i-1;j>0;j--){
//if a black pixel has been found
//than we probably have a bar put the white pixel in arrayofbars[]
if(arrayofbars[j]=="b"){
arrayofbars[i]="w"; i++;
break; } }}
if(arrayofbars.Length!=0){

You have a lot of wrong code here...
if ( arrayofbars.Length != 0 )
Of course it never 0, you just set it to 250!!! So what really you want to do?!
if ( pixel == Color.Black ) { arrayofbars[ i ] = "b"; i++; } else for ( int j = i - 1; j > 0; j-- ) { //if a black pixel has been found //than we probably have a bar put the white pixel in arrayofbars[] if ( arrayofbars[ j ] == "b" ) { arrayofbars[ i ] = "w"; i++; break; } }
If the very first pixel is not black you run into a very interesting loop
for ( int j = -1; j > 0; j-- )
